The law of conservation of mass states that in a closed system, mass cannot be created or destroyed; it can only change forms. This principle is a fundamental concept in chemistry and physics, and it means that during a chemical reaction, the total mass of the reactants will be equal to the total mass of the products.

The type of chemical bond that involves the sharing of electrons is a covalent bond. In a covalent bond, atoms share electrons to achieve a more stable electron configuration and form molecules.

The unit of measurement for the amount of substance in chemistry is the mole (mol). A mole is defined as the amount of substance that contains the same number of entities (atoms, molecules, ions, etc.) as there are atoms in exactly 12 grams of carbon-12.

The chemical name for vitamin C is ascorbic acid. It is an essential nutrient for humans and is known for its antioxidant properties.

The process by which a solid changes directly into a gas without becoming a liquid is called sublimation. Sublimation occurs when the substance's vapor pressure exceeds its atmospheric pressure at a certain temperature, allowing the solid to transform directly into a gaseous state.

The main function of enzymes in biological systems is to catalyze (speed up) chemical reactions. Enzymes are protein molecules that act as biological catalysts, lowering the activation energy required for a reaction to occur. They enable biochemical reactions to proceed at a suitable rate under the conditions present in living organisms, without being consumed or altered in the process. Enzymes play a crucial role in various biological processes, including digestion, metabolism, and cellular signaling.
